Scott isn't prejudiced against all women (except for Candace Melanie, a girl he bothers from some childish "war" between them), but he does try to sleep with as many as he can. Unlike Warp, Scott is lazy. He works out on his crop fields with much care and dignity, as he takes pride in his produce (and to him, he can mean that statement BOTH ways.) If it isn't crop-related, he usually does not like doing any extra work. If a villain attacks his home, however, he will go out of his way to stop them or destroy them, whichever comes first. Scott has enmity for all of his foes, but Commander Blackstar is his own personal enemy in his mind. Scott can be a loyal friend, but he has a mainly perverted sense of humor which ticks off a majority of people if it gets out of hand...
